Port Count and Speed
Choosing the right network switch for a multi-PC VR setup hinges heavily on port count and speed. I recommend at least 8 ports to connect multiple VR PCs and accessories without hassle. Higher port counts give you room to expand and keep everything connected smoothly. Speed is equally critical; gigabit (1Gbps) or multi-gigabit (2.5Gbps, 10Gbps) ports ensure plenty of bandwidth for seamless VR experiences across all devices. Switches with 10Gbps SFP+ or multi-gig ports handle high data transfer rates better, reducing latency and bottlenecks. Also, look for auto-negotiation and link aggregation support, which optimize speeds and keep data flowing efficiently. Supporting full duplex operation maximizes data flow, helping to deliver the smooth, immersive VR performance you need.
Power Over Ethernet (Poe) Support
Power over Ethernet (PoE) support can significantly simplify your multi-PC VR setup by delivering both power and data through a single cable. This eliminates the need for separate power adapters and reduces cable clutter, making installation cleaner and more efficient. When choosing a switch, look for models that provide enough PoE ports with a sufficient power budget to support all your connected devices simultaneously. Standard PoE typically offers up to 15.4W per port, while PoE+ increases that to 30W, and newer standards like PoE++ can deliver up to 60W or 90W per port. Ensuring your switch supports the right PoE standard and has a generous power budget is essential for reliably powering VR equipment, wireless access points, or other network devices without additional power sources.
Network Management Features
Network management features play a crucial role in optimizing multi-PC VR setups by giving you better control over your network traffic. With VLAN support, QoS, and port mirroring, you can segment traffic, prioritize VR data, and monitor network activity, ensuring smooth, low-latency performance. Managed switches enable centralized control over settings, making configuration, troubleshooting, and securing multiple devices easier. Advanced tools like SNMP and network analytics help identify bottlenecks and maintain consistent low latency, which is essential for immersive VR experiences. Features such as loop prevention and storm control protect your network from disruptions caused by misconfigurations or device failures. Additionally, cloud management options allow remote monitoring and adjustments, offering flexibility and convenience for maintaining a stable, high-performance multi-PC VR network from anywhere.
